1. Explore the Old City

The Old City is a UNESCO World Heritage Site and home to some of the most iconic attractions in Quebec City. Start your exploration with a walk along the cobblestone streets of the Petit-Champlain district, then visit the iconic Château Frontenac and Place-Royale. Don’t forget to take in the stunning views of the St. Lawrence River from the Terrasse Dufferin.

7. Visit the Citadelle of Quebec

The Citadelle of Quebec is a historic fortress located atop Cap Diamant. It’s a great place to explore, with a variety of exhibits and activities. You can also take in the stunning views of the city from the top of the fortress.

8. Explore the Montmorency Falls

The Montmorency Falls is one of the most spectacular sights in Quebec City. You can take a cable car to the top of the falls and take in the stunning views, or take a boat tour to explore the base of the falls.
